CESTAT Allahabad rules service tax not applicable to restaurant takeaway food, affirming it as a sale of goods based on judicial precedents.
CESTAT Mumbai held that taxing entirety of income as consideration under ‘management, maintenance or repair service’ without disaggregating consideration among several activities is lack of wherewithal. Accordingly, order set aside and matter remanded back.
Patna High Court held that extended period of limitation of five years under proviso to Sub-Section (1) of Section 73 of the Finance Act, 1994 in as much as transactions were not disclosed in ST-3 and relevant information were not provided to taxing authority.
CESTAT Hyderabad rules Section 142(3) CGST Act doesn’t grant cash refund for service tax paid post-GST if not eligible under prior laws.
CESTAT Chennai rules CENVAT credit re-credited before GST, but not usable after, must be granted as cash refund, citing impracticality and CGST Act.
CESTAT Hyderabad held that the activity of investment in mutual fund does not involve the presence of a service rendered by a service provider towards a recipient of service for some consideration.
Gujarat High Court dismisses tax department appeal, rules simultaneous penalties under Sections 76 and 78 of Finance Act, 1994, not permissible.
CESTAT Ahmedabad rules material value from separate supply contracts not includible in works contract service value for period before July 7, 2009 amendment.
CESTAT Delhi rules that time spent pursuing an appeal before the wrong forum, based on official guidance, can be excluded from limitation.
CESTAT Delhi rules incentives to advertising agency from media houses for targets are not taxable under Section 66E(e) as no obligation exists.
